Specific function: Required for the expression of the V-dependent nitrogen fixation system in Azotobacter vinelandii. It is required for the regulation of nitrogenase 2 transcription. Interacts with sigma- 54 [H]

COG id: COG3604

COG function: function code KT; Transcriptional regulator containing GAF, AAA-type ATPase, and DNA binding domains
